Ignore:
Timestamp:
2008-12-25T19:01:06+01:00 (16 years ago)
Author:
stoecker
Message:

updated a lot

Location:
applications/editors/josm/plugins/tagging-preset-tester
Files:
1 deleted
2 edited

Legend:

Unmodified
Added
Removed
  • applications/editors/josm/plugins/tagging-preset-tester/build.xml

    r7287 r12588  
    1515    <echo message="creating ${plugin.jar}"/>
    1616    <mkdir dir="build"/>
    17     <javac srcdir="src" destdir="build" classpath="../../core/dist/josm-custom.jar" />
     17    <javac srcdir="src" destdir="build" classpath="../../core/dist/josm-custom.jar">
     18      <compilerarg value="-Xlint:deprecation"/>
     19    </javac>
    1820  </target>
    1921
    2022  <target name="dist" depends="compile">
    2123    <mkdir dir="dist"/>
    22     <jar destfile="${plugin.jar}"
    23          basedir="build"
    24          manifest="src/org/openstreetmap/josm/plugins/taggingpresettester/MANIFEST.MF">
     24    <exec append="false" output="REVISION" executable="svn" failifexecutionfails="false">
     25      <env key="LANG" value="C"/>
     26      <arg value="info"/>
     27      <arg value="--xml"/>
     28      <arg value="."/>
     29    </exec>
     30    <xmlproperty file="REVISION" prefix="version" keepRoot="false" collapseAttributes="true"/>
     31    <delete file="REVISION"/>
     32    <jar destfile="${plugin.jar}" basedir="build">
     33      <manifest>
     34        <attribute name="Plugin-Version" value="${version.entry.commit.revision}"/>
     35        <attribute name="Plugin-Date" value="${version.entry.commit.date}"/>
     36        <attribute name="Plugin-Description" value="Make the Tagging Preset Tester tool available in the help menu." />
     37        <attribute name="Main-Class" value="org.openstreetmap.josm.plugins.taggingpresettester.TaggingPresetTester" />
     38        <attribute name="Plugin-Class" value="org.openstreetmap.josm.plugins.taggingpresettester.TaggingPresetTesterAction" />
     39        <attribute name="Plugin-Mainversion" value="1180" />
     40      </manifest>
    2541      <fileset dir="."><include name="images/*"/></fileset>
    2642    </jar>
  • applications/editors/josm/plugins/tagging-preset-tester/src/org/openstreetmap/josm/plugins/taggingpresettester/TaggingPresetTesterAction.java

    r3639 r12588  
    1010import org.openstreetmap.josm.Main;
    1111import org.openstreetmap.josm.actions.JosmAction;
     12import org.openstreetmap.josm.gui.MainMenu;
     13import org.openstreetmap.josm.tools.Shortcut;
    1214
    1315/**
     
    1820
    1921        public TaggingPresetTesterAction() {
    20                 super(tr("Tagging Preset Tester"), "tagging-preset-tester", tr("Open the tagging preset test tool for previewing tagging preset dialogs."), KeyEvent.VK_A, KeyEvent.CTRL_DOWN_MASK | KeyEvent.ALT_DOWN_MASK, true);
     22                super(tr("Tagging Preset Tester"), "tagging-preset-tester",
     23                tr("Open the tagging preset test tool for previewing tagging preset dialogs."),
     24                Shortcut.registerShortcut("tools:taggingresettester",
     25                tr("Tool: {0}", tr("Tagging Preset Tester")),
     26                KeyEvent.VK_A, Shortcut.GROUP_EDIT, Shortcut.SHIFT_DEFAULT), true);
    2127                Main.main.menu.helpMenu.addSeparator();
    22                 Main.main.menu.helpMenu.add(this);
     28                MainMenu.add(Main.main.menu.helpMenu, this);
    2329        }
    2430
Note: See TracChangeset for help on using the changeset viewer.